📝 Match Report

How It Unfolded

Benfica beat Arouca 0-3 at Estádio Municipal de Arouca, Regular Season - 16, in the Primeira Liga. The remainder of the report sets that outcome against the pre-match model, the markets and the teams' data profiles.

The Model vs The Result

The Poisson model went into this projecting Arouca 0.82 xG and Benfica 1.33 xG, a combined 2.15. The scoreboard read 0-3 for 3 actual goals. Arouca fell 0.8 short of their projected output. Benfica outscored their 1.33 projection by 1.7. Those figures were built on strength ratings of Arouca attack 0.87 / defence 1.01 against Benfica attack 1.10 / defence 0.62, drawn from 49/49 games (CurrentSeason).

On the result, the model split it Arouca 23% | Draw 28% | Benfica 49%, with Benfica to win its most likely call at 49%. The result followed the model's preferred path, landing its top-rated outcome.
